Your Opportunity

Our Markham or Oakville office is looking for an Intermediate Associate to join the Financial Reporting & Insights team. This is an existing vacancy where you will own the following responsibilities:

  • Prepare compilation engagements, including year-end working paper files, financial statements, and supporting documentation, for clients in a variety of industries.
  • Prepare and review corporate (T2), personal (T1), trust (T3), and partnership tax returns.
  • Prepare information returns and slips, including T4, T4A, T5, and related CRA filings.
  • Build positive working relationships with clients to communicate directly, request information, discuss accounting matters, and effectively respond to inquiries.
  • Identify and resolve accounting and bookkeeping issues while supporting managers and partners in delivering high-quality client service and meeting deadlines.
  • Effectively communicate with team members regarding progress updates and issues on an ongoing basis.
  • Participate in business development initiatives and identify new business opportunities with existing clients.
  • Invest in the professional development of your team by engaging in training and mentoring junior team members.
